Transaction 4e75cb2adea4f7af53a5324c3245c9ef438037fab3f71fcb977d2a76c8bbc566
1 Input
2 Outputs
- 4e75cb2adea4f7af53a5324c3245c9ef438037fab3f71fcb977d2a76c8bbc566:0
- 4e75cb2adea4f7af53a5324c3245c9ef438037fab3f71fcb977d2a76c8bbc566:1
value 1508670000
address 1EM9T3ShfsLddiKuKq2Go1kJdauKxezki
value 321293027
address 1Lsqcv4cg5zUctNi2qwNxMkrv1GeBboSUJ